Below the hood: The significance of sump pumps
A sump pump is your home’s most effective defense in case of melting snow or heavy rain threatens to flood your basement. Sump pump is installed in a pit, known as a sump basin, in the lowest part of the basement or crawl space. They are intended to channel water away from foundations, which can cause the structural damage, water damage, and the growth of mold. It is crucial to keep the sump pumps and set them up properly in order to ensure that they function properly when you most need their assistance.

Condensate Pumps: Keep humidity down and houses dry
To provide indoor comfort, humidity control is crucial. In HVAC systems, condensate pumps play a vital role in managing excess moisture that is generated by the cooling process. They remove and store condensate, which prevents the accumulation of water in the HVAC system. This can lead inefficiency, mold and damage. Condensate Pumps assist in maintaining ideal humidity levels and enhance the overall efficiency of the HVAC System.
Progressive cavity pumps – the next generation of fluid transfer
Progressive cavity pumps have transformed fluid transfer and handling procedures across many industries. These pumps are designed with an helical-rotor as well as a stator to provide a constant flow of fluid. This makes them ideal for viscous or hard materials. The cavity pump that is progressive ensures an exact fluid flow and reduces the time it takes to repair. They can be utilized in many industries, including oil and gas processing, food processing wastewater treatment, and more because of their flexibility and strength.
Discover the advantages of purification systems for water.
Water treatment systems are essential for improving the quality and safety of our water supply. These systems remove impurities, harmful substances, and contaminants, ensuring that the water we consume and drink in our houses is safe for drinking and cooking as well as bathing. Water treatment systems utilize a variety of techniques such as the purification, disinfection, and filtration to eliminate chemical contaminants, bacteria, and viruses.
